Strategy to “out compete” closest competitors
The strategy we would use to out compete the closest competitors D,H and I, is to
use a growth and cost-leadership strategy.
By looking at this chart, you can see that our company F has a very low amount of
chain stores open in comparison to the rest of the companies. This is a major factor
that affected our potential to be very high. By using the growth strategy and
expanding the size and scope of the operations, we can provide more products to
various markets around the world. If more online and chain stores are opened
within the next two years, the company would have a higher chance to out-compete
the other competitors. The other strategy to out-compete the competitors would be
to use the cost-leadership strategy. By looking at companies D,H,I one could see that
they had relatively low prices in the entry level segment, and high prices in the
multi-featured segment. In order to compete with these companies, our company
should seek ways in order to operate with low costs. By operating with low costs,
the products can be sold at low prices and in return bring more demand into the
market. Through using low costs and opening more stores to a variety of markets,
our company will bring in more demand through the use of expansion within the
next two years. . By using these two strategies, our company can strive to eliminate
the other competitors and become one of the strongest competitors.
